How to Pick Your Perfect Supplier: 5 Questions to Ask

Choosing a supplier isn’t just about comparing specs. It’s about finding someone who understands your unique needs. Here’s how to narrow it down:

  • “Can you show me a case study like my project?” A great supplier won’t just say “we can do it”—they’ll prove it with a similar client’s success story. If you run a brewery, ask for a brewery treatment plant they built.
  • “What happens when something breaks?” Look for suppliers with local service centers or 24/7 hotlines. EverGreen, for example, has tech teams in 15 countries—so if your system acts up in Mexico City, help is never far.
  • “Do you meet my country’s standards?” Europe’s CE mark, the US’s EPA certifications, Australia’s AS/NZS—your supplier should know these like the back of their hand. BlueWave even offers “pre-approval audits” to make sure your system passes local inspections the first time.
  • “Can you grow with me?” Your factory might process 1000m³/day now, but what if you expand in 5 years? ClearFlow designs systems that can be upgraded with new modules—no need to buy a whole new machine.
  • “What’s your ‘green promise’?” The best suppliers don’t just sell “eco-friendly” machines—they live sustainability. Ask: Do they use recycled materials in their own factories? Do they offset their carbon footprint?

FAQ: Real Questions from Real Buyers

Q: How much does a mid-sized sewage treatment system cost?
A: It depends on capacity, tech (wet vs. dry), and customization. Expect to pay $50,000–$200,000 for systems handling 100–500m³/day. But remember: Most clients see ROI in 1–3 years through water savings and compliance avoidance.
Q: How long does installation take?
A: Small systems (under 200m³/day) take 2–4 weeks. Larger, custom projects? 3–6 months. The best suppliers (like GreenPulse) handle everything from permits to training, so you can focus on your business.
Q: Are Chinese systems compatible with Western parts?
A: Absolutely. Top suppliers use global-standard components (Siemens motors, Pentair filters) so you can source parts locally. SmartWater even includes a “parts list” with every system, so your local technician knows exactly what to order.
